The ingredients needed to make Blueberry Bread Pudding:
  1. Prepare 120 grams bread crusts
  2. Prepare 1 package blueberries (frozen)
  3. Prepare 2 Eggs
  4. Take 200 ml Milk
  5. Prepare 200 ml Heavy cream
  6. Take 50 grams granulated sugar or regular sugar
  7. Make ready 1 Tbsp Liqueur (Kirsch, Gran Marnier, etc)
  8. Take 1/2 Tbsp Cake flour (if you're using frozen fruit)
  9. Prepare 1 Margarine or butter (to grease the container)

Steps to make Blueberry Bread Pudding:
  1. Coat an oven-safe container with margarine or butter. Preheat the oven to 190°C/375°F. if using a gas oven, then 170°C ~180°C (340°F~350°F). You can also use a few small ramekins if you wish.
  2. Break and beat the eggs in a bowl, add the granulated sugar, milk, heavy cream, and liqueur and mix together, being careful not to let it bubble.
  3. If using frozen fruit, coat the fruit with cake flour so that the color doesn't bleed into the batter, which will keep the end result nice and neat!!
  4. Soak the crusts in the mixture from Step 2. When the oven is finished preheating, put the soaked crusts into the oven safe dish and top with the fruit.
  5. Bake for 20 minutes. If you like it a little crispier, then let it bake a little longer.
  6. If you don't have any heavy cream, you can just use more milk. You can change the liqueur to vanilla essence if you prefer. You can also use baguettes, multi grain bread, or white bread as not just the crusts will get hard on these breads.
